About State Street

10,000+ employees

State Street is a global custodian bank and asset manager serving institutional investors with investment servicing, fund accounting, trading/FX, data, and index/active strategies. Its products include State Street Global Advisors’ funds and ETFs, the Charles River Investment Management Solution, and the front-to-back State Street Alpha platform. Founded in 1792 and headquartered in Boston, the company is publicly traded on the NYSE (ticker: STT) and operates across major markets worldwide.
